Consider a car with a cash price of $4,000, offered on the installment plan for $146 per month for 36 months.
Calculate (a) the total installment price, (b) the carrying charges, and (c) the number of months needed to save the money at the monthly rate to buy the car for its cash price.
Use commas and decimal points in your answers when appropriate. Round to two decimal places if necessary
(a) The total installment price is $5256 .
(b) The carrying charges is $1256 .
(c) The number of months needed to save the money at the monthly rate to buy the car for its cash price is 28 months .
In the question,
it is given that
Price of the car in cash = $4000
amount to be paid as installment per month = $146
time for installment = 36 months
Part(a)
the total installment price can be calculated using the formula
total price = (per month installment) * (number of months)
Substituting the values , we get
total price = 146*36
= 5256
So , total installment price = $5256
Part(b)
the carrying charges can be calculates using the formula
carrying charges = total installment price - price in cash
Substituting the values ,we get
carrying charges = 5256-4000
= 1256
So, carrying charges = $1256
Part(c)
the number of months needed to save the money at the monthly rate to buy the car for its cash price , can be calculated using the formula .
number of months = (price in cash)/(monthly rate)
= 4000/146
= 27.39
rounding , we get
≈ 28
number of months = 28 months
Therefore , (a) The total installment price is $5256 .
(b) The carrying charges is $1256 .
(c) The number of months needed to save the money at the monthly rate to buy the car for its cash price is 28 months .

200 college freshmen were interviewed, 95 were registered for a math class, 80 were registered for an english class, and 60 were registered for both math and english how many signed up neither for math nor english?
Total number of college freshmen that signed up neither math nor English is 85
Total number of college freshmen interviewed = 200
Number of college freshmen registered for a Math class = 95
Number of college freshmen registered for a English class = 80
Number of college freshmen registered for both math and English = 60
Total number of college freshmen signed up either for math or English = Number of college freshmen registered for a Math class + Number of college freshmen registered for a English class - Number of college freshmen registered for both math and English
Total number of college freshmen signed up either for math or English = (95 + 80 - 60) = 115
Total number of college freshmen signed up neither math nor English = ( Total number of college freshmen interviewed - Total number of college freshmen signed up either for math or English )
Total number of college freshmen signed up neither math nor English = 200 -115 = 85
Thus, 85 college freshmen signed up neither math nor English.

suppose y varies directly with x. write a direct vairation equation that relates x and y. y=-10 when x=2
Answer:
y = - 5x
Step-by-step explanation:
given y varies directly with x then the equation relating them is
y = kx ← k is the constant of variation
to find k use the condition y = - 10 when x = 2 , then
- 10 = 2k ( divide both sides by 2 )
- 5 = k
y = - 5x ← equation of variation
